Best 62898 Illinois Public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public schools serving 497 students in 62898, IL.
The top-ranked public schools in 62898, IL are Woodlawn Grade School and Woodlawn High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public schools in zipcode 62898 have an average math proficiency score of 26% (versus the Illinois public school average of 27%), and reading proficiency score of 27% (versus the 30% statewide average). Schools in 62898, IL have an average ranking of 5/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Illinois public schools.
Minority enrollment is 7%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Illinois public school average of 55% (majority Hispanic).
